Fredericton (cda), Nb vs Ustica Island Climate & Distance Between

Italy flag
  • The distance between Fredericton (cda), Nb, Canada and Ustica Island, Italy is approximately 6,335 km or 3,936 mi.
  • To reach Fredericton (cda), Nb in this distance one would set out from Ustica Island bearing 305.3° or NW and follow the great circles arc to approach Fredericton (cda), Nb bearing 246.4° or WSW .
  • Fredericton (cda), Nb has a warm summer continental/ hemiboreal climate with no dry season (Dfb) whereas Ustica Island has a Mediterranean hot climate (Csa).
  • The annual mean temperature is 11.6 °C (20.9°F) cooler.
  • Average monthly temperatures vary by 14.6 °C (26.3°F) more in Fredericton (cda), Nb. The continentality subtype is truly continental as opposed to truly oceanic.
  • Total annual precipitation averages 645.8 mm (25.4 in) more which is equivalent to 645.8 l/m² (15.85 US gal/ft²) or 6,458,000 l/ha (690,403 US gal/ac) more. About 2 4/9 as much.
  • The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 7.2° lower in Fredericton (cda), Nb than in Ustica Island.
